2.(a) Explaih the dispersion of light in a prism. (b) A ray of white light is incident on an equilateral prism at an angle of 45 degrees. The emergent ray has an angle of deviation of 60 degrees. Calculate the refractive index of the prism for red light and violet light. 3. (a) Define the term "angle of minimum deviation" for a prism.
